    I have downloaded the loco plugin and i want to change the ADD TO CART buttons text to the greek word ΑΓΟΡΑ. I followed the instructions from the woodmart documentation and the video, however the button isn’t getting translated, i added the word in greek in woodmart theme and Child theme and woocommerce and pressed save and sync and still I don’t see it changing in the website. Please help.

    I also want to translate add to compare and add to wishlist.

    Hello,

    Please use the Loco Translate plugin on your site. After installing the plugin, please navigate to Loco >> Themes >> Woodmart >> Edit the translation which you are using for the site >> Click the Sync button >> Find the words and add the translation for them and save it.

    Also, please navigate to Loco >> Plugins >> Woocommerce >> Edit the translation which you are using for the site >> Click the Sync button >> Find the words and add the translation for them and save it.

    Also, please navigate to Loco >> Plugins >> Woodmart-Core >> Edit the translation which you are using for the site >> Click the Sync button >> Find the words and add the translation for them and save it.

    Hello,

    Your issue has been solved. I have translated and set up the theme translation files. Now, if you want to translate any more words, please go to Loco >> Themes >> Woodmart >> Edit the Greek Language file, find the words, translate them, and save the file.

    There is no need to translate the child theme; in the loco translation, you will not lose the translation after the theme update.
